This classic Italian cocktail features Campari, red vermouth, and gin. The bitterness of the Campari is tempered by the sweetness of the vermouth. Add in my beloved gin and it is pure heaven in a glass. A perfect, bracing aperitif to wake up the taste buds. I love how cheerful Negronis look, too.

Ingredients:

1 1/2 oz sweet vermouth
1 1/2 oz Campari
1 1/2 oz gin
Orange slice or twist for garnish

Directions:

1. Pour the ingredients into an old-fashioned glass with ice cubes. Stir well.
Ingredients for a Negroni

2. Garnish with the orange slice.

Makes one drink
